Webof a slope is as the percent of the vertical change relative to horizontal change. This can be measured in the field or on a topographic map. A slope with 1-foot vertical change for each horizontal foot is a 100% grade. A 4-inch drain pipe will need the same slope as a 6-inch drainpipe. It can be very hard to get the exact slope you want on a drain pipe. The minimum … WebDig a Trench. Dig a trench from the place in your yard that needs drainage to your chosen outlet. Check for underground utility lines and pipes before digging. The trench should be about 18 inches deep and 9 to 12 inches wide. French drains need to have a slope of at least 1 percent, so the force of gravity will work for you. ingenuity helicopter video on mars
